gpt4 book ai didi

javascript - 达到 60 秒时休息倒计时功能

转载 作者:行者123 更新时间:2023-11-30 11:14:33 29 4
gpt4 key购买 nike

我有一个计数器函数,我从这个 Answer 得到它:

  function countDown(i) {
var int = setInterval(function () {
document.querySelector(".count").innerHTML = "Number: " + i;
i-- || clearInterval(int); //if i is 0, then stop the interval
}, 1000);
}
countDown(60);

所以当它完成计数时,它会停在 0;

当计数器停在零时我想要实现的目标是我想重置函数以从 60 倒计时到 0。

是否可以重置该功能?此刻我真的迷路了

最佳答案

实现此目的的最简单方法是根本不停止计数器。只需将 i 的值为 0 时的值设置为 60。

function countDown(i) {
var int = setInterval(function () {
document.querySelector(".count").innerHTML = "Number: " + i;
i = i > 0 ? i - 1 : 60;
}, 1000);
}
countDown(60);

关于javascript - 达到 60 秒时休息倒计时功能,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52157267/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com